Weeelll....THE packages arrived - for the most part - yesterday. I was on the way home for my 1/2 day off when my wife called to say the Fed Ex van had just pulled up. I was 15 minutes out - by the time I arrived, the van was gone and the monsters were in the garage. I was changing into my homewear when my wife came in and said, "I thought you said there would be 8 boxes?"........I ran back to the garage - 1 QS8 MIA. I called Axiom and they provided the tracking number for the missing box. Undeterred, I set up the rest of the system using my old surround for the missing QS8. SO......now I have run the YPAO and - which, btw, didn't sound exactly right with a weak center and sub. I broke out the RS meter that I bought about 2 months back and went through the manual set. I think I did it properly...I turned on the test tones, turned the master volume to 0 and then tweaked the individual speaker levels until I achieved 75db? I left the sub bumped to around 78....anyway I was switching from old CD's to the new "Classical Starter Pack" to DVDs to TV for the rest of the day. Flat ran out of time - just as some of you predicted. Also, just as you predicted, it was addicting to hear everything like it was the first time.

ANYone hesitating on these speakers should rest easy. It is all true. They reveal exactly what is on the CD and do it with authority. I promise that I did not "drink the Kool Aid" - it is true! I now know what everyone is talking about on the aquarium scene in Nemo.
